Product reviews:
Malcolm
2025-06-18 iphone SE
LEGO Marvel Super Heroes Avengers lego infinity war sets walmart
lego infinity war sets walmart
Ron
2025-06-15 iphone XS Max
Marvel Super Heroes Avengers 3 Infinity lego infinity war sets walmart
lego infinity war sets walmart
LEGO Sets Up to 40% Off at Best Buy lego infinity war sets walmart
lego infinity war sets walmart